Three-sauce BBQ wings are an irresistible appetizer that will satisfy chicken lovers.

This recipe from petelinka.ru suggests cook wings, grilled, and served with three different homemade sauces. You can choose a Caucasian sauce based on matsoni or yogurt, a sweet and sour Asian sauce or a spicy Mediterranean sauce – or try all three!

Ingredients (for 11 servings):

— 4 packs of wings in BBQ sauce,

– any fat for lubricating the grates.

For the Caucasian sauce:

– 500 g matsoni, yogurt or yogurt,

– 100 g of greens (cilantro, basil, tarragon, green onions),

– 1 teaspoon hops-suneli,

– salt to taste.

For the Asian Hot Sauce:

– 2 pcs. red chili pepper,

– 4 cm fresh ginger root,

– 4 cloves of garlic,

– 100 ml soy sauce,

– 50 ml liquid honey,

– 30 ml apple cider vinegar,

– salt to taste.

For the Mediterranean sauce:

— 1 jar (250-300 g) sun-dried tomatoes in oil,

– 1 can of pitted olives,

– 3-4 sprigs of basil,

– 2 cloves of garlic,

– sal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ste.

Preparation:

  1. For the Caucasian sauce, finely chop the greens, salt them, sprinkle with suneli hops and chop finely. Mix the greens with your chosen dairy product (matsoni, yogurt or curdled milk). Leave to brew for 1-2 hours.
  2. For the spicy Asian sauce, peel and grate fresh ginger root and garlic. Finely chop the red chili pepper. Mix the ginger, garlic and chili with all the other ingredients listed for the Asian sauce. Leave to brew for 1-2 hours.
  3. For the Mediterranean sauce, crush and peel the garlic and chop the basil. Place olives in a sieve to remove liquid. In a blender, combine all the ingredients for the Mediterranean sauce, including the tomatoes in the oil, and blend until smooth. Leave to brew for 1-2 hours.
  4. Light the coals in the barbecue or grill. Preheat the grill and grease it with any fat to prevent the wings from sticking. Place the wings on the grill and cook, turning every 3 minutes, until cooked through. This usually takes about 25 minutes.
  5. Serve the wings with your choice of sauces.
